The Fernhollow reminder job sends appointment notifications for the clinic scheduling system. It runs as a scheduled batch task, not a long-lived service, and holds no inbound network exposure. Outbound traffic is limited to the messaging gateway and the appointments database replica. Patient identifiers are tokenized before leaving the job's process; raw records never enter logs. Secrets are mounted at runtime and rotated on each deploy. For review purposes, the deployed configuration for the production environment is reproduced below.

config for yajep-tafof:
[rusath]
team = julmir
access_code = ac_fe37fd
host = rusath.novactech.test
port = 8000
owner = pelmir.weneth
peer = oliwyn.olvarqdyn.internal

Subject: DR drill next Thursday — Fernlock SFTP drop

Hi — quick heads-up: we're running the disaster-recovery drill for the Fernlock partner drop on Thursday morning. You'll fail over to the Maribeth standby host, re-upload the sample batch, and confirm the poller picks it up. Nothing scary, takes about an hour. Keys are already staged on the standby; to unlock the staging keyring, use the passphrase below.

recovery phrase for yajof-tafog: gilath-druok-kasax-tamvan-aldath-prair-gorir-istwyn-normir-novok

Briefing — Leadership Review, Heads of Department, Solmere Software

This briefing outlines the proposed move from monthly to annual billing for the Ardent platform. Modeling suggests improved cash predictability and reduced churn, offset by a one-quarter revenue timing dip. Customer communications, discount structure, and migration sequencing have been drafted and reviewed with legal. The strategic context for this change is provided confidentially below.

board note of baguf-fafog: Kasixox Foods plans to lower the Drueth list price by 48 percent in March.

## Further reading

The migration of the Torvane build to our hermetic build system (Kilnworks) is tracked in phases: vendoring third-party sources, pinning toolchains, and removing network access from build steps. Release managers should note that phase two changes artifact hashes, so release comparisons across the boundary are not byte-identical by design — verify via the provenance manifest instead. Rollback is supported until phase three completes. The full migration plan, phase status, and cut-over criteria are on the internal page below.

runbook for taduf-kawef: https://confluence.qorvelsys.internal/projects/display/display/pages